The Pakistan cricket team has once again been fined for maintaining a slow over rate.

According to an official statement by the ICC, Pakistan was penalized for a slow over rate in the second ODI against New Zealand.  

The team was found to be one over short of the required rate within the allotted time, resulting in a fine of 5% of the match fee. Captain Mohammad Rizwan accepted the penalty.  

It is worth noting that Pakistan was also fined for a slow over rate in the first ODI.
